Texas Instruments (TI) Microcontrollers support forum is an extensive online knowledge base where millions of technical questions and solutions are available 24/7. You can search for content on other microcontrollers or ask technical support questions on the extensive portfolio of microcontrollers. Find the right solution for your circuit design challenges by using our TI E2E™ support forums that are supported by thousands of contributing TI experts.
